J.V. has its ups, downs
J.V. football coach, Mike Fantaski, was pleased by the
over-all effort and support the players exchanged with
each other, "The team worked well together because the
teammates exchanged team support and encouragement
throughout the football season."
The team starts the season out by having practices
during the summer and sometimes practicing twice a day,
once in the morning, then they come back in the afternoon
for another workout. When the school year starts, the team
will sometimes practice with the varsity team to get the
experience they need. The football team has an up-down
list, which is a list of football players that are on the junior
varsity team, but sometimes will be seen in one or two of
the varsity games.
The J.V. football season started Sept. 1, with the team
winning against Millard South, 25-18, and just barely losing
their second game to Omaha Gross, 26-27.
